Kuje Prison Attack: Soldiers block entry, exit roads into Abuja 

Emerging from the gunmen’s attack at Kuje prison on Tuesday late night, soldiers have reportedly blocked the checkpoints from motorists entering and leaving the city.

Wakadaily gathered that gunmen invaded the Kuje prison late night Tuesday and attacked the Medium Security Custodial Centre, in Abuja. mission to rescue their colleague who is in the prison.

The Nigerian Correctional Service had earlier confirmed the incident.

It says “I wish to confirm that at about 2200hrs, some yet-to-be-identified gunmen attacked the Medium Security Custodial Centre, Kuje, in the Federal Capital Territory.

“However, men of the Armed Squad of the Nigerian Correctional Service and other security agencies attached to the Custodial Centre have responded and calm has been restored to the facility and the situation is under control.”

Private vehicle owners and commercial vehicles made a U-turn back to the city following the time clam are completely restored. Passengers were seen descending from the bus and trekking back to their homes.

According to reports, the Kuje road leading to the airport road is blocked, and even the exit road from Kuje leading to Gwagwalada has been blocked as well.
